Fluorine in PDB 6ugz: Human Carbonic Anhydrase IX-Mimic Complexed with SB4-208

Protein crystallography data

The structure of Human Carbonic Anhydrase IX-Mimic Complexed with SB4-208, PDB code: 6ugz was solved by A.B.Murray, C.L.Lomelino, R.Mckenna,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 30.44 / 1.31
Space group P 1 21 1
Cell size a, b, c (Å), α, β, γ (°) 42.193, 41.587, 72.094, 90.00, 103.80, 90.00
R / Rfree (%) 16.1 / 17.3
